What Is Flat Lamination PUR Hot Melt Adhesive?
Flat Lamination PUR (Polyurethane Reactive) Hot Melt Adhesive is a high-performance industrial adhesive designed specifically for bonding decorative materials onto flat panels.
Unlike conventional hot melt adhesives, PUR hot melt adhesives not only cool to form an initial bond but also chemically react with moisture in the air to create a permanent, cross-linked structure. This unique curing process results in exceptionally strong, flexible, and durable bonds.
How Does It Work?
The bonding process takes place in two stages:
Stage 1 – Hot Melt Bonding
The adhesive is heated and applied in molten form using a roller or slot nozzle. It provides an immediate initial bond as it cools.
Stage 2 – Moisture Curing
After application, the adhesive reacts with moisture from the surrounding environment and the bonded materials. This chemical reaction strengthens the bond and significantly improves resistance to heat, moisture, and ageing.

Suitable Substrates
Flat Lamination PUR Hot Melt Adhesive can bond a wide range of materials, including:
Base Materials
- MDF
- Particle Board
- Plywood
- HDF
- Block Board
Decorative Materials
- PVC Foils
- PET Films
- Acrylic Sheets
- Decorative Laminates
- Veneers
- Decorative Paper
- High Gloss Films
- Melamine Surfaces

Benefits of Using PUR Hot Melt for Flat Lamination
Superior Bond Strength
PUR adhesives develop extremely strong bonds that remain reliable even after years of use.
Excellent Heat Resistance
Finished panels maintain bond integrity even under elevated temperatures, reducing the risk of delamination.
Moisture Resistance
Ideal for applications exposed to humidity, such as kitchens and bathrooms.
Improved Surface Quality
PUR adhesives produce clean, smooth laminated surfaces without visible imperfections.
Faster Manufacturing
The quick initial set allows manufacturers to increase production speed and improve workflow efficiency.
Reduced Adhesive Consumption
Compared to many traditional adhesive systems, PUR technology often achieves strong bonds with lower adhesive application rates, helping optimize production costs.

Best Practices for Application
To achieve the best results:
- Store adhesive according to the manufacturer’s recommendations.
- Ensure substrates are clean, dry, and dust-free.
- Maintain the recommended application temperature.
- Apply a uniform adhesive layer.
- Use proper pressure during lamination.
- Allow adequate curing time before machining or heavy handling.
Common Causes of Bond Failure
Bond failures are often caused by:
- Dirty substrates
- Incorrect application temperature
- Low pressing pressure
- Excessive machine speed
- Poor storage conditions
- Contaminated rollers
- Inadequate curing time
Following recommended processing parameters helps prevent these issues.
